We want to use Microsoft Ads Conversions API (CAPI) for server-side tracking. Currently, we are not seeing the "Send events from your server" or "Conversions API" option in our UET tag settings. Please enable CAPI access for our account.

    CAPI cannot be enabled directly from the UET tag settings by end users. Access to the Conversions API is currently in a pilot program and must be provisioned for the account by Microsoft.

    To proceed:

    1. Contact the Microsoft Advertising account manager or Microsoft Advertising support and request enrollment in the Conversions API pilot for the specific customer account (CID).
    2. After enrollment, obtain the Conversions API auth token from the Microsoft Advertising UI by selecting Use Conversions API for the UET tag.
    3. Use the provided UET tagID and the auth token to send events to the CAPI endpoint:
         https://capi.uet.microsoft.com/v1/{tagID}/events
      
      with the header:
         Authorization: Bearer <ApiToken>
      

    Until the account is added to the pilot and the token is issued, the “Send events from your server” / “Conversions API” option will not appear in the UET tag settings.
